In depth

Èze charter, in depth.

Èze is a medieval village on a rock 400 metres above the sea, with the Jardin Exotique at its summit and the Chemin de Nietzsche running down to Èze-sur-Mer on the shoreline. It has no marina and no superyacht berth, and any charter that includes Èze does so from a berth or anchorage nearby.

That is not a limitation so much as the shape of the destination: yachts lie at Beaulieu-sur-Mer, in the Rade de Villefranche or at Port Hercule, and guests go up by car for lunch, the gardens and the view along the coast to Cap Ferrat. It is the classic non-nautical afternoon of an eastern Riviera week.

Best Time to Visit

When to charter in Èze.

MonthWeatherProsConsCrowd
April19°C air / 16°C seaPre-season — full availability, ideal for shoulder corporate eventsSea cool, beach clubs only weekendsLow
May22°C air / 19°C seaF1 Grand Prix week is the social high point of the yearOutside F1 sea still cool; F1 week 50–100% premiumMedium peak F1 week
June26°C air / 22°C seaWarm water, every restaurant open, sensible pricing — the smartest month for a luxury yacht charter MonacoCannes Lions advertising festival (third week) inflates Cannes-area berthsMedium
July29°C air / 25°C seaLong days, full Riviera social calendarPremium rates, advance berth booking essential everywhereHigh
August31°C air / 26°C seaWarmest sea, peak RivieraHighest prices of summer, hardest berths in Cannes/Saint-TropezVery high
September27°C air / 24°C seaMonaco Yacht Show end-September — biggest superyacht week of the European calendarMYS week is the most expensive berthing week of the year; outside MYS, lower rates and warm seaVery high MYS week

Local Insider Tips

Insider knowledge for your Èze charter.

  • Èze has no harbour — plan the visit from Beaulieu, Villefranche or Monaco.
  • The Jardin Exotique at the top of the village gives the best view on this part of the coast; go early or late to avoid coach traffic.
  • The Chemin de Nietzsche links Èze-sur-Mer to the village on foot; it is steep and takes about an hour uphill.
  • Car transfers along the Moyenne Corniche are slow in summer — allow more time than the distance suggests.

Experiences ashore

What is worth a shore day here?

Chapelle Saint-Pierre

Fishermen's chapel on the quay, decorated by Jean Cocteau in 1957.

Directly beside the tender landing in the old town.

  • Record: attraction · verified · verified Jul 2026 · source
  • Distance to marina: 0.1 km · indicative

Chemin de Nietzsche

The stepped path from Èze-sur-Mer up to the medieval village, walked by Nietzsche in 1883.

Land the tender at Èze-sur-Mer and climb — roughly an hour up, steep, no shade after 10:00.

  • Record: attraction · verified · verified Jul 2026 · source
  • Distance to marina: 5 km · indicative

Citadelle Saint-Elme

Sixteenth-century citadel above the Darse, housing the town museums.

Five minutes on foot from the harbour, with the full view over the rade.

  • Record: attraction · verified · verified Jul 2026 · source
  • Distance to marina: 0.3 km · indicative

Jardin Exotique d'Èze

Cactus and succulent garden on the ruined castle site at the top of Èze village.

The view point of the eastern Riviera, reached by car from Beaulieu or Monaco.

  • Record: attraction · verified · verified Jul 2026 · source
  • Distance to marina: 5 km · indicative
